Abstract
In a fishing reel of a double bearing type, a spool including two flanges respectively on the two sides thereof is supported between the two side plates of a reel main body in such a manner that the spool can be freely rotated when a fishline is played out, and, as a brake mechanism, the brake portion of a brake device for preventing the over-rotation of the spool by use of an eddy current caused by a magnet or by use of the centrifugal force of a brake shoe is stored and located within the fishline winding barrel portion of the spool, whereby the axial direction of a spool shaft can be reduced and thus the reel main body can be made compact.
